Keratoconus is a progressive eye disease that affects the cornea, leading to distorted vision. The condition causes the normally round cornea to thin and bulge into a cone-like shape, impacting how light enters the eye. As a result, individuals with keratoconus often experience blurry, double, or ghosted vision. What is Keratoconus?
Keratoconus typically begins during adolescence or early adulthood and gradually worsens over time. The cornea’s irregular shape disrupts light’s ability to focus properly on the retina, leading to visual distortions. If left untreated, the condition can progress to the point where glasses or standard contact lenses can no longer correct the vision problems. In severe cases, it may even result in significant vision loss.
The progression of keratoconus can vary widely. Some individuals experience rapid deterioration in vision, while others may have a slow progression. Regardless of the speed of progression, it’s crucial to identify and treat the condition early to prevent further damage.
Keratoconus Vision Examples Before Treatment
To better understand the visual challenges faced by people with keratoconus, let’s look at some common keratoconus vision examples before treatment:
Blurry Vision: One of the first symptoms of keratoconus is blurry vision. As the cornea becomes more misshapen, objects that should be sharp and clear appear blurry, similar to looking through a foggy or smeared lens. People often have trouble with activities that require detailed vision, such as reading or driving.
Double Vision or Ghosting: Many people with keratoconus experience double vision or ghosting, where objects appear to have a faint duplicate beside them. This occurs because the irregular shape of the cornea causes light to scatter as it enters the eye, leading to multiple overlapping images. This is a common complaint in keratoconus vision examples before treatment.
Halos and Starbursts: Bright lights can be especially problematic for people with keratoconus. Halos or starbursts around lights are common, particularly when driving at night. This symptom can make night driving extremely dangerous.
Treatment Options for Keratoconus
Although keratoconus is a progressive condition, several treatment options can halt its progression and, in many cases, improve vision. A keratoconus specialist will recommend the most appropriate treatment based on the severity of the disease and the patient’s specific needs. Below are the most common treatment options, along with examples of vision improvement post-treatment:
Glasses or Soft Contact Lenses: In the early stages of keratoconus, glasses or soft contact lenses may be sufficient to correct mild vision problems. However, as the condition progresses and the cornea becomes more irregular, these solutions often become less effective. In keratoconus vision examples after early treatment, patients may notice modest improvements, but this option is usually temporary as the disease advances.
Rigid Gas Permeable (RGP) Lenses: RGP lenses are hard lenses that provide a smooth refractive surface over the cornea, helping to correct the irregularities caused by keratoconus. For patients with moderate keratoconus, keratoconus vision examples after RGP lenses often show significant improvement in visual clarity. These lenses are more effective at managing the condition than soft lenses.
Scleral Lenses: Scleral lenses are larger than traditional contact lenses and rest on the white part of the eye, vaulting over the cornea. This design creates a smooth surface for light to enter the eye and provides clearer vision. Many keratoconus vision examples after scleral lenses show that patients enjoy improved comfort and visual acuity, especially in advanced cases of the disease.
Corneal Cross-Linking (CXL): Corneal cross-linking is a minimally invasive procedure that strengthens the cornea by using ultraviolet light and riboflavin to create bonds between collagen fibers in the cornea. This treatment can halt the progression of keratoconus and prevent further vision loss. Although corneal cross-linking doesn’t immediately improve vision, keratoconus vision examples show that it helps stabilize the condition, allowing for better correction with lenses post-treatment.
Intacs: Intacs are small, arc-shaped implants that are surgically placed in the cornea to flatten its shape and reduce the bulging. In keratoconus vision examples after Intacs, patients often experience a reduction in visual distortions and improved clarity. Intacs are typically used when contact lenses are no longer effective, but a corneal transplant isn’t yet necessary.
Corneal Transplant: In severe cases of keratoconus where other treatments are no longer effective, a corneal transplant may be required. This procedure replaces the damaged cornea with a healthy cornea from a donor. Keratoconus vision examples post-transplant often show significant improvements in vision, though glasses or contact lenses may still be necessary to achieve optimal visual acuity.
Keratoconus Vision Examples: After Treatment
After undergoing treatment for keratoconus, most patients experience significant improvements in their vision. Some examples of keratoconus vision examples after treatment include:
Clearer Vision: Many patients report a dramatic improvement in clarity, particularly with RGP or scleral lenses. Activities such as reading, driving, and recognizing faces become much easier.
Reduction in Halos and Starbursts: With treatments like corneal cross-linking and Intacs, patients often experience fewer halos and starbursts around bright lights. Nighttime vision becomes clearer, making night driving less challenging.
Improved Comfort: Scleral lenses, in particular, are known for their comfort. Patients who have switched from RGP lenses to scleral lenses often find that their vision improves while experiencing less irritation.
